I own a G&P T12, and this light is junk. I can't imagine every buying anything else coming from g&p/digilight (theyre all the same anyway, all they do is make up idiotic names)
 
T12:
The switch internals are copied from the surefire Z57 - but even worse. it really 'feels' like junk
The light has plenty of o-rings, but some of them dont make contact
The front lens has an o-ring, but at the wrong side. At the place where it should be is no surface that could support an o-ring
